    Richard M. Restak M.D. è un rinomato neuroscienziato, neuropsichiatra e scrittore. È autore di diciannove acclamati libri sul cervello che sono diventati bestseller. Il suo lavoro approfondisce il funzionamento della mente, svelando le complessità del pensiero e del comportamento umano. Restak scrive con chiarezza e coinvolgimento, rendendo il mondo affascinante delle neuroscienze accessibile a un vasto pubblico.
